“Young God (also known as Raping A Slave) was originally released in 1984 as an untitled EP shortly after S W A N S' sophomore record of Cop. The New York group's abstract, abrasive and abhorrent style of Industrialized Noise Rock resumes in continuation on this twenty-four minute EP. Michael Gira's obsession towards the concepts of power and control are also revisited here once more.
